In this paper, a fast greedy method for data reduction in near-field antenna testing is proposed. Starting from the recent Warping Driven Greedy Method, the execution times of the latter can be further improved by considering as the initial set of points of the iterative procedure, those of the measurement aperture that do not exceed the size of the antenna. A numerical example shows that the proposed approach has the same performance as the classical one but with a lower computation burden.
